The Yankees are optimistic that their new acquisition can excel wherever he\u2019s asked to play defensively.\u00a0<\/span><\/p>\n<h3><strong>What Does Chisholm Bring to the Club?<\/strong><\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Chisholm is a playmaker. His running game is aggressive and he does not fear the arm of any catcher. This year alone, he\u2019s swiped 22 bags in 30 attempts. His speedy tendencies lead to extra-base hits and added pressure on the defense and pitcher.\u00a0<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">His bat is streaky and more on the dependable side. Chisholm Jr has a <a  href=\"https:\/\/baseballsavant.mlb.com\/savant-player\/jazz-chisholm-jr-665862\" target=\"_blank\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\">10.7% barrel percentage<\/a>, ranking a 74 value. This season he has 96 hits with 50 RBI, 13 home runs, and 46 runs scored. He\u2019s slashed .249\/.323\/.407 so far on the year.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Chisholm Jr.\u2019s batted ball profile is similar to 2024\u2019s version of <a href=\"https:\/\/www.baseball-reference.com\/search\/search.fcgi?pid=murphse01,murphy011sea,murphy010sea,murphy013sea&amp;search=Sean+Murphy&amp;utm_medium=linker&amp;utm_source=lastwordonsports.com&amp;utm_campaign=2024-07-28_br\" target=\"_blank\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\">Sean Murphy<\/a> of the Atlanta Braves and 2022\u2019s version of <a href=\"https:\/\/www.baseball-reference.com\/players\/m\/mountry01.shtml?utm_medium=linker&amp;utm_source=lastwordonsports.com&amp;utm_campaign=2024-07-28_br\" target=\"_blank\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\">Ryan Mountcastle<\/a> of the Baltimore Orioles. He has climbed quickly through the ranks and is now protected on the Marlins&#8217; 40-man roster.\u00a0<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Ram\u00edrez spent time between Double-A and Triple-A this season. With 90 hits on the year, he drove in 69 runs and mashed 20 home runs. Ram\u00edrez was on the come-up. and the Yankees are giving up a highly projectable hitting catcher with the potential to be a starter.\u00a0\u00a0<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Ram\u00edrez quickly moves into the fourth-ranked spot in the Marlins&#8217; top 30 prospect list.\u00a0<\/span><\/p>\n<h3><strong>Infielder Serna Brings Depth to Marlins Farm System<\/strong><\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">The Yankees signed <a  href=\"https:\/\/www.baseball-reference.com\/register\/player.fcgi?id=serna-000jar&amp;utm_medium=linker&amp;utm_source=lastwordonsports.com&amp;utm_campaign=2024-07-28_br\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\">Jared Serna<\/a> in the 2019 international signing period out of Mexico. Last season, Serna proved he wasn\u2019t just a gamble in the signings by displaying good offensive qualities.\u00a0<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Between Low-A and High-A, Serna recorded 144 hits, 79 RBI, and 19 home runs. His bat is above average with a compact swing and contact prone. He gets the barrel through the zone with a good plane on his launch.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Serna is a menace on the bases, generating plenty of speed and momentum. He stole 29 bags last year and is currency at 11 this year. His defense is dependable, with the ability to play three spots on the infield.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">The Yankees lose their 19th-ranked prospect in Serna. However, Miami&#8217;s infield depth ranging from the majors to the next up-and-comers in the minors will delay his promotional time.\u00a0<\/span><\/p>\n<h3><strong>Abrahan Ram\u00edrez: The Third Wheel in the Deal<\/strong><\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><a  href=\"https:\/\/www.baseball-reference.com\/register\/player.fcgi?id=ramire002abr&amp;utm_medium=linker&amp;utm_source=lastwordonsports.com&amp;utm_campaign=2024-07-28_br\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\">Abrahan Ram\u00edrez<\/a> was also a product of the international signing period.
